How To Apply Paper Joint Tape. Here are general directions on how to tape drywall to create a smooth surface for mudding the joints. Applying a single layer of paper tape will help minimize any chance of ending. Place a piece of paper drywall tape over the wet mud in the joint. Apply the tape by holding one end of the tape against the joint with your hand while drawing away the banjo to. Once the tape is embedded, apply a second layer of joint compound over the tape, feathering the edges to blend it into the surrounding drywall.
